Transaction 31486ee8f783f322eb3de7582c65bfdca9d1788c67632222b50783783a7beeaa
1 Input
1 Output
-
31486ee8f783f322eb3de7582c65bfdca9d1788c67632222b50783783a7beeaa:0
- value
- 1037444
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d74b9befd85253e6d296b2b67caf1983545a0ce OP_EQUAL
- address
- 3BfmQgrzfW5vHsTfiZ1myyJCLkq7DsRhTD